Buildings with views in Brooklyn Heights

Brooklyn Heights is a historic neighborhood known for its brownstone buildings and proximity to the waterfront. It boasts 408+ buildings that provide access to views of the Manhattan skyline and the East River. This charming area also features a strong community feel, making it a desirable place to live. The average building rating in Brooklyn Heights is 3.7/5 across 35 rated buildings, indicating a generally favorable living experience. Residents enjoy well-maintained properties and convenient access to local amenities, parks, and public transportation. (building-level trends; individual units can differ)

What to check before for buildings with views in Brooklyn Heights

  • Expect scenic views from many building units, including waterfront or skyline perspectives.
  • Confirm any additional fees related to view-oriented units, as these may differ from standard rates.
  • Check for common restrictions or requirements related to leases, especially for high-demand buildings with views.
  • Review tenant feedback on noise levels and light, as these can vary significantly with view placements.
  • Assess outdoor spaces and common areas that may enhance or obstruct your view experience.
